Heterozygous C282Y mutation

Heterozygotes of the C282Y mutation represent a small proportion of patients with hemochromatosis. This subgroup is not well studied, and the natural history of their disease is poorly understood.12 Approximately 25% of heterozygotes have abnormal iron studies.1 A smaller percentage have iron overload as high as that of homozygotes. Complications caused by iron overload in heterozygotes have generally only been reported in association with other risk factors, usually viral hepatitis, alcohol use, or porphyria cutanea tarda.

Heterozygosity for C282Y is more prevalent in individuals with viral or autoimmune hepatitis. Some evidence suggests that patients with viral hepatitis who are heterozygous for C282Y may have more severe symptoms and respond less well to therapy.13 Thus, increased serum iron concentration may influence the course of the disease.13 These concomitant conditions may also augment iron deposition.1,14

In the 2 cases presented here, these predisposing factors were not thought to be significant contributors. Medications were regarded as the facilitating factor that led to more pronounced symptoms and eventually to the diagnosis of the disease. It is unlikely that the implicated medications contributed to iron accumulation, particularly given their brief use; rather, they exacerbated a subclinical hepatic insufficiency. In these 2 patients, the manifestations of iron overload during the 8th decade of life rather than the typical 5th decade was probably the result of their heterozygosity and decreased propensity to absorb iron from the gastrointestinal tract.
